hack up libproxychains.so to contain some glibc symbolsmusl-preload
this is needed to run a musl-linked proxychains against some glibc binaries (after they have their interpreter overwritten with patchelf to point to musl's dynlinker.)

diff --git a/src/legacy.c b/src/legacy.c
new file mode 100644
index 000000000..de32966
--- /dev/null
+++ b/src/legacy.c
@@ -0,0 +1,481 @@
+int __res_ninit() {
+ return 0;
+}
+
+void __pthread_register_cancel(void* p) {
+
+}
+
+void __pthread_unregister_cancel(void *p) {
+
+}
+
+#include <setjmp.h>
+int __sigsetjmp(sigjmp_buf buf, int save) {
+ return sigsetjmp(buf, save);
+}
+
+static __thread void* thread_arg;
+static __thread int (*thread_compar)(const void*, const void*, void*);
+static int my_thread_compare_func(const void* a, const void* b) {
+ return thread_compar(a, b, thread_arg);
+}
+#include <stddef.h>
+#include <stdlib.h>
+void qsort_r(void* base, size_t nmemb, size_t size, int (*compar)(const void*, const void*, void*), void *arg) {
+ thread_arg = arg;
+ thread_compar = compar;
+ return qsort(base, nmemb, size, my_thread_compare_func);
+}
+
+int backtrace(void **buffer, int size) {
+ return 0;
+}
+
+char **backtrace_symbols(void *const *buffer, int size) {
+ return 0;
+}
+
+#include <pthread.h>
+int __register_atfork(void (*prepare) (void), void (*parent) (void), void (*child) (void), void * __dso_handle) {
+ return pthread_atfork(prepare, parent, child);
+}
+
+#define _GNU_SOURCE
+#include <poll.h>
+#include <setjmp.h>
+#include <stdarg.h>
+#include <stdio.h>
+#include <stdlib.h>
+#include <string.h>
+#include <sys/socket.h>
+#include <syslog.h>
+#include <unistd.h>
+#include <wchar.h>
+
+__attribute((noreturn)) void __chk_fail(void)
+{
+ write(2, "buffer overflow detected\n", 25);
+ abort();
+}
+
+int __asprintf_chk(char **s, int flag, const char *fmt, ...)
+{
+ va_list ap;
+ int r;
+ va_start(ap,fmt);
